引言 在当今互联网应用高速发展的时代,数据库作为系统的核心组件,面临着越来越大的并发访问压力。随着业务规模的不断扩大,单一数据库实例已经无法满足高并发、大数据量的处理需求。如何构建一个能够支持高并发访问、具备良好扩展性的数据库架构,成为了每个技术团队必须面对的重要课题。 本文将深
时光旅人
这个人很懒,什么都没有写。
引言 随着前端应用复杂度的不断提升,传统的单体式前端架构已经难以满足现代企业级应用的需求。如何构建一个可扩展、可维护、高性能的前端工程化架构,成为了前端开发者面临的重要挑战。本文将深入探讨基于Webpack 5的现代化构建体系,以及如何通过模块联邦技术实现微前端架构,为企业级前端
引言 在现代企业级应用开发中,微服务架构已成为构建大规模分布式系统的主流范式。随着业务复杂度的不断增加,传统的单体应用已难以满足敏捷开发、快速迭代和高可用性等需求。然而,微服务架构在带来灵活性和可扩展性的同时,也引入了复杂的网络通信、服务治理、安全控制等问题。 在众多微服务架构设
引言 随着企业数字化转型的深入发展,微服务架构已成为构建现代应用系统的主流选择。微服务通过将大型单体应用拆分为多个独立的服务,提高了系统的可扩展性、可维护性和开发效率。然而,这种架构模式也带来了新的挑战,特别是在数据管理方面。 在传统的单体应用中,数据存储相对简单,通常采用单一数
引言 随着云计算技术的快速发展,云原生架构已成为现代应用开发和运维的核心理念。在这一趋势下,数据库作为应用系统的重要组成部分,也需要向云原生方向演进。传统的数据库部署方式已经难以满足现代应用对弹性、可扩展性和高可用性的需求。 Kubernetes作为容器编排领域的事实标准,为云原
引言 Node.js作为基于Chrome V8引擎的JavaScript运行时环境,凭借其单线程、非阻塞I/O模型,在处理高并发场景时展现出卓越的性能优势。然而,随着业务复杂度的提升和用户量的增长,如何设计高效的Node.js应用架构,优化事件循环机制,有效检测和预防内存泄漏,成
引言 随着云原生架构的快速发展,微服务治理成为企业数字化转型的关键环节。服务网格作为微服务架构的重要基础设施,为服务间通信提供了统一的管控平台。在众多服务网格解决方案中,Istio、Linkerd和Consul凭借其各自的技术特点和生态优势,成为了业界主流选择。 本文将基于真实的
引言 Node.js 18作为LTS版本,为开发者带来了众多重要更新和改进。随着JavaScript生态系统的发展,Node.js也在不断演进以满足现代应用开发的需求。本文将深入探讨Node.js 18中的关键新特性,特别是ES Modules原生支持、内置Fetch API以及
引言 在现代微服务架构中,服务间的高效通信是系统整体性能的关键因素。随着业务规模的扩大和用户并发量的增长,传统的REST API通信方式逐渐暴露出性能瓶颈。与此同时,gRPC作为一种新兴的高性能RPC框架,凭借其高效的序列化机制和优秀的性能表现,正在成为微服务通信的新选择。 本文
引言 在现代微服务架构中,API网关作为系统的重要组成部分,承担着路由转发、安全认证、限流熔断等关键职责。Spring Cloud Gateway作为Spring Cloud生态中的核心组件,为微服务架构提供了强大的网关解决方案。本文将深入探讨Spring Cloud Gatew
Go语言并发编程深度剖析:goroutine调度机制与channel通信模式详解 引言 Go语言自诞生以来,凭借其简洁的语法、强大的并发支持和高效的性能,迅速成为构建高并发应用的首选语言之一。Go语言的并发模型基于CSP(Communicating Sequential Proc
引言:为什么需要完善的错误处理体系? 在现代Web应用开发中, 健壮的错误处理机制 是构建可维护、高可用系统的关键一环。尤其是在使用Node.js和Express构建后端服务时,由于其异步非阻塞特性,错误若未被妥善处理,极易导致进程崩溃、资源泄漏甚至数据不一致。 尽管Expres
